Why Fit Matters More Than Any Spec on the Label

A backpack's capacity, weight, and features all matter, but none of them matter as much as fit — an ill-fitting pack turns even a moderate load into a genuinely miserable, sometimes injury-causing experience, while a well-fitted pack lets you carry real weight comfortably for hours. This guide covers capacity sizing, frame type, and — most importantly — how to actually evaluate fit, so you buy a pack that works with your body rather than against it.

1. Capacity: Matching Liters to Trip Length

Backpack capacity is measured in liters, and the right size depends primarily on trip duration and season, not just personal preference.

Trip TypeTypical Capacity Range
Day hiking15–30 liters
Overnight to 2-night trip30–50 liters
3–5 night trip50–65 liters
Extended trip (5+ nights) or winter camping (bulkier gear)65–80+ liters

A pack that's too large for the trip tends to get overpacked — extra space gets filled with items you don't actually need, adding unnecessary weight. Choosing an appropriately sized pack for your typical trip length is itself a form of weight discipline.

2. Internal Frame vs. External Frame vs. Frameless

Frame TypeHow It WorksBest ForTradeoffs
Internal frameFrame integrated inside the pack body, close to your backThe standard modern choice for most backpacking, good balance and load transferSlightly less ventilation against your back than external frame designs
External frameFrame visible outside the pack body, pack attached to itVery heavy, irregular loads (less common now, some hunting-specific packs)Bulkier, less common for standard backpacking, but excellent for carrying heavy/awkward loads like game meat
FramelessNo rigid frame, relying on the pack's shape and tight packing for structureUltralight backpacking with genuinely light total pack weightOnly comfortable with a light total load; uncomfortable if overloaded since there's no frame to transfer weight to your hips

For most beginner backpackers, an internal frame pack is the right default choice — it's the most versatile option across trip types and load weights, and what most modern backpacking packs are built around.

3. How Backpacks Actually Carry Weight

Understanding this changes how you should evaluate fit: a well-fitted pack transfers the majority of its weight to your hips, not your shoulders.

  • The hip belt should bear roughly 80% of the pack's weight, resting on your actual hip bones (the iliac crest), not sitting up on your waist above them.
  • Shoulder straps stabilize the pack and carry the remaining weight, but shouldn't be the primary weight-bearing point — if your shoulders feel like they're doing most of the work, the pack likely isn't fitted or adjusted correctly.
  • This is why torso length (not your height) determines the correct pack size — a pack sized to your torso positions the hip belt and shoulder straps correctly relative to your specific body, regardless of how tall or short you are.

4. Measuring Torso Length and Sizing Correctly

  • Torso length is measured from the C7 vertebra (the prominent bone at the base of your neck when you tilt your head forward) to the top of your iliac crest (hip bone), typically measured with a soft tape measure, ideally with help from another person.
  • This measurement, not your overall height, is what backpack sizing (often labeled S/M/L or by inch ranges) is actually based on — two people of the same height can need meaningfully different pack sizes if their torso lengths differ.
  • Most quality backpacks come in multiple sizes specifically because torso length varies independently of height — don't assume a "one-size" or generically sized pack will fit correctly regardless of your measurements.
  • Many packs also have adjustable torso length (via a sliding harness system), which adds fitting flexibility, especially useful for a growing teen or if you're between standard sizes.

5. Trying On and Adjusting a Pack

  1. Load the pack with realistic weight before evaluating fit — an empty pack tells you very little about how it will actually feel loaded.
  2. Loosen all straps, then put the pack on and tighten the hip belt first, centering it on your hip bones with the buckle at your navel roughly.
  3. Tighten shoulder straps so they wrap comfortably over your shoulders without gaps, but without bearing the bulk of the weight (which should already be on your hips).
  4. Adjust load lifter straps (connecting the top of the shoulder straps to the pack body) to a roughly 45-degree angle, pulling the pack's upper weight closer to your body without over-tightening.

  1. Adjust the sternum strap (connecting the shoulder straps across your chest) for stability, snug but not restricting breathing.
  2. Walk around for several minutes, ideally on uneven ground or stairs if available, checking for shoulder rubbing, hip belt slipping, or weight that doesn't feel centered — a quick standing try-on in a store often misses issues that show up with actual movement.

Don't Skip This: Fit a backpack loaded with real weight, not empty, and walk around for more than a minute or two before deciding it fits well. A pack that feels fine standing still for thirty seconds can reveal real fit problems once you're actually moving with a realistic load — this is the single most common mistake in backpack shopping.

6. Features Worth Considering

  • Adjustable hip belt and shoulder straps (beyond just torso length adjustment) help fine-tune fit for your specific body shape.
  • Ventilated back panel (trampoline-style mesh suspension) improves airflow against your back, a genuine comfort benefit in warm weather at a small weight cost.
  • Hip belt pockets for quick-access items (snacks, phone, small navigation tools) without needing to remove the pack.
  • External attachment points (loops, straps) for items that don't fit inside, like trekking poles or a sleeping pad, useful for both organization and expanding effective capacity.
  • Rain cover (built-in or separate) protects pack contents in wet weather — some packs include one, others require purchasing separately.
  • Hydration reservoir compatibility (a sleeve and port for a hydration bladder) is standard on most modern packs but worth confirming if you plan to use one.

7. Common Backpack Buying Mistakes

  • Sizing by height or general assumption rather than actual measured torso length, leading to a pack that doesn't fit correctly regardless of how good the pack itself is.
  • Trying on an empty pack and judging fit from that alone, missing how the pack actually feels and distributes weight under a realistic load.
  • Buying too much capacity "to be safe," encouraging overpacking and unnecessary weight rather than matching capacity to actual typical trip length.
  • Not adjusting the hip belt to bear the majority of the weight, ending up with sore shoulders from a pack that's technically fitted but not adjusted correctly.
  • Ignoring load lifter straps and sternum strap adjustment, missing meaningful comfort and stability improvements that cost nothing extra once the pack is owned.
  • Not testing with a walk or stairs, missing fit issues that only appear with actual movement rather than standing still.

Final Takeaway

The right backpack is less about finding the "best" pack on paper and more about matching capacity to your actual trip length, choosing the right frame type for your needs, and — most importantly — fitting the pack to your measured torso length and adjusting it so your hips, not your shoulders, carry the bulk of the weight. Try any pack on loaded with real weight and walk around before deciding, since fit problems rarely show up in a quick, empty-pack try-on.

Backpack sizing systems and fit conventions vary somewhat between manufacturers — always confirm actual torso-length fit ranges for the specific pack model you're considering rather than assuming sizing is consistent across brands.
